## Notice

We intend to award a framework agreement for Mountain Bike Trail and Skills Park Design, Construction and Maintenance throughout the Forestry Commission estate in England. Our intention is to award this framework agreement for a period of four years The framework is divided into 13 lots. Lots 1 to 10 will be for MTB trail maintenance and lots 11 to 13 will be for design and build of new trails. The estimated total value of the framework across all lots is in the region of PS2,000,000. Additional information: The contracting authority considers that this contract may be suitable for economic operators that are small or medium enterprises (SMEs). However, any selection of tenderers will be based solely on the criteria set out for the procurement.
